Artificial Intelligence, better known as AI, is becoming increasingly popular and intertwined with everyday aspects of our lives. From a simple Google search, opening your phone with Face ID, to social media, AI is everywhere. But what is AI? In layman terms, AI is a combination of Machine Learning and Deep Learning to efficiently perform tasks that would otherwise require human intelligence. AI uses large sets of data analysis to identify patterns, and make predictions on the basis of those patterns while slowly optimizing itself with each cycle for increased efficiency and efficacy.

  1. Amazon Alexa

Alexa is Amazon’s AI application virtual assistant. Initially used in Amazon Echo and other Amazon Smart Speakers, it helps assist its users in various different tasks. From creating to-do-lists, setting alarms, streaming music and podcasts, providing traffic and weather updates, sports related news, general news, to so much more. One of its major applications is as a smart home automation system, where you can sync smart devices all around your home and control them through simple voice commands.   1. ELSA Speaks

ELSA (English Language Speech Assistant) is an AI app that coaches users how to speak English through interactive bite-sized lessons and dialogues. Using an intelligent, adaptive learning system with real-time speech recognition, its AI coach helps users stay motivated, focused, and on track. ELSA currently has over 4 million downloads and boasts over 3.6 million users around the globe.

  1. Socratic

Acquired by Google in March of 2018, Socratic is another AI app that has made headlines in the eLearning industry. Aimed towards academia, Socratic helps students of highschool, colleges, and universities with easier accessibility to information. Students can simply take a picture of their work which Socratic scans to surface relevant information, guides, tips, tricks, and other resources from the web, pertaining to their desired subject or question, as well as visual explanations of the concepts students want to learn.

How do AI-based apps work?

Applications of Artificial Intelligence work by using technologies such as machine learning, natural language processing, and computer vision to analyze data, make decisions, and perform tasks. Here’s a general overview of how these technologies work:

  • Machine learning: Machine learning is a subset of AI that involves training algorithms to automatically improve their performance on a task by analyzing data. AI apps use machine learning models and algorithms to process large amounts of data and make predictions or decisions based on that data.
  • Natural language processing: Natural language processing (NLP) is a branch of AI that focuses on the interaction between computers and human languages. AI apps that use natural language understanding can understand, interpret, and respond to human language in real-time, making human-computer interactions more natural.
  • Computer vision: Computer vision is a field of AI that focuses on enabling computers to interpret and understand visual information from the world. AI apps that use computer vision can analyze images and videos to identify objects, recognize patterns, and perform tasks such as image processing, classification, and object detection.

These technologies allow Applications of Artificial Intelligence to perform tasks that would normally require human intelligence, such as recognizing patterns in data, making predictions, and providing recommendations. The more data an AI-based app is trained on, the more accurate and sophisticated its decisions and predictions become.

Are AI apps secure?

AI apps, like any other software, can have security vulnerabilities that can be exploited by attackers. While AI algorithms and technologies can help enhance the security of applications, they can also introduce new security risks. Some of the security risks associated with AI-based apps include:

  • Data privacy: AI apps can process large amounts of sensitive data, which can be vulnerable to theft or unauthorized access.
  • Model theft: AI models can be stolen or reverse-engineered by attackers, allowing them to impersonate the AI system or use it for malicious purposes.
  • Adversarial attacks: AI systems can be vulnerable to adversarial attacks, where an attacker deliberately feeds the system with malicious data to manipulate its decisions or outputs.
  • Bias and discrimination: AI systems can perpetuate or even amplify existing biases in the data used to train them, leading to discriminatory outcomes.

To minimize security risks, it’s important for AI apps to be designed and developed with security in mind. This includes implementing proper authentication and access controls, regularly updating and patching the app, and using encryption to protect sensitive data. Additionally, it’s important for organizations to regularly monitor and assess the security of their AI systems to detect and respond to potential threats.

Can AI apps replace human jobs?

AI apps can automate certain tasks and make them more efficient, but they are not designed to replace human jobs entirely. While some jobs may become obsolete as a result of automation, AI is also creating new job opportunities and enabling humans to focus on higher-value tasks. For example, the increased efficiency provided by AI can free up time for human workers to focus on more creative or strategic tasks, rather than performing repetitive or manual tasks. AI can also enhance the capabilities of human workers, allowing them to work more effectively and make more informed decisions. Additionally, the development and deployment of AI systems require a significant amount of human expertise, including software engineers, data scientists, and other professionals. These jobs are likely to become more in-demand as the use of AI continues to grow. In short, while AI may change the nature of some jobs, it is not likely to completely replace human jobs. Instead, it is likely to create new job opportunities and change the nature of existing jobs.

What is the connection between AI apps and the Internet of Things (IoT)?

AI apps and the Internet of Things (IoT) are interconnected in multiple ways. AI can help process and analyze the vast amounts of data generated by IoT devices, and use that data to drive insights, predictions, and automation. On the other hand, IoT devices can provide AI apps with real-time data and feedback, enabling them to learn and adapt to changing conditions.
